VitePress

3周前发布 527 00

由 Vite 和 Vue 驱动的静态网站生成器

所在地:
加拿大
收录时间:
2024-11-23
VitePressVitePress
VitePress

VitePress:极速构建精美文档站的得力助手

 

VitePress(https://vitepress.dev/)是一款基于 Vite 和 Vue 驱动的静态站点生成器,专注于为开发者提供一种快速、高效且极具灵活性的方式来创建美观、功能丰富的文档网站。它将简洁的 Markdown 写作与强大的前端技术相结合,以出色的性能和丰富的定制化选项,在文档生成领域脱颖而出,成为众多开发者记录项目、分享知识的理想选择。

专注内容创作的高效体验

 

  1. Markdown 驱动的便捷写作:VitePress 以 Markdown 作为核心内容创作格式,让开发者能够专注于文档内容本身,无需花费过多精力在复杂的排版和格式设置上。Markdown 的简洁语法使得撰写文档变得轻松自然,无论是编写技术教程、项目说明还是 API 文档,都能迅速上手。只需简单地使用标记符号,即可快速组织文本结构、添加标题、列表、链接、图片等元素,极大地提高了文档编写的效率。例如,在编写一篇技术博客时,开发者可以通过 Markdown 快速构建文章框架,专注于阐述技术要点和思路,而无需分心于样式调整。
  2. 即时预览与高效迭代:借助 Vite 的强大功能,VitePress 实现了即时的服务器启动和闪电般快速的热更新。在编写文档过程中,开发者可以实时预览文档的最终呈现效果,每一次保存 Markdown 文件,页面都会立即更新,展示最新的修改内容。这种即时反馈机制使得文档创作过程更加流畅,开发者能够快速验证自己的想法,及时发现并纠正错误,大大缩短了文档迭代周期。无论是修改一个段落的文字、调整代码示例,还是更新文档结构,都能在瞬间看到变化,仿佛在与文档进行实时对话。

卓越的性能表现

 

  1. 快速的初始加载速度:VitePress 生成的文档站点以静态 HTML 文件形式呈现,这确保了在用户首次访问时能够实现快速的初始加载。与动态站点相比,无需等待服务器端的动态渲染过程,静态文件可以直接被浏览器缓存和加载,大大缩短了用户等待时间。无论是在网络状况不佳的环境下,还是对于大型文档库的访问,VitePress 都能迅速展示文档内容,为用户提供流畅的阅读体验。例如,当用户访问一个包含大量技术文档的网站时,VitePress 能够快速呈现页面,让用户无需长时间等待即可开始阅读所需信息。
  2. 流畅的客户端路由导航:在页面加载后,VitePress 利用客户端路由技术实现了快速的导航切换。当用户在文档站点内进行页面跳转时,无需重新加载整个页面,而是通过高效的 JavaScript 代码动态更新页面内容,实现无缝切换。这种方式不仅提高了导航速度,还为用户提供了更加流畅的交互体验,使得在文档之间的浏览如同在本地应用程序中操作一样顺滑。例如,在浏览一个包含多个章节和子章节的文档时,用户可以快速在不同页面之间切换,而不会感受到明显的卡顿或延迟。

深度定制与灵活性

 

  1. Vue 语法与组件的融入:VitePress 允许开发者直接在 Markdown 中使用 Vue 语法和组件,为文档增添丰富的交互性和动态效果。开发者可以在文档中嵌入 Vue 组件,如按钮、表单、图表等,实现更加生动和功能强大的展示效果。同时,利用 Vue 的响应式原理,还可以创建动态交互的文档内容,例如根据用户操作显示或隐藏特定的信息块、实现实时数据更新的示例等。这种融合使得文档不再是静态的文本,而是可以与用户进行互动的应用程序,提升了文档的实用性和吸引力。
  2. 基于 Vue 的主题定制能力:对于追求个性化的开发者,VitePress 提供了基于 Vue 的强大主题定制功能。开发者可以根据项目的品牌形象和风格需求,完全定制文档站点的外观和布局。从页面颜色、字体样式到整体布局结构,都可以通过编写 Vue 组件和样式来实现。此外,还可以利用 Vue 的生态系统,引入各种 UI 库和工具,进一步扩展主题的功能和样式选项。无论是打造简洁现代的技术文档,还是富有创意的项目展示网站,VitePress 都能提供足够的灵活性来满足开发者的创意需求。

与 Vite 生态系统的无缝集成

 

  1. 插件扩展功能增强:作为 Vite 生态系统的一部分,VitePress 能够充分利用 Vite 的插件机制,通过安装和使用各种 Vite 插件来扩展其功能。例如,可以使用代码高亮插件提升代码示例的可读性,使用 SEO 优化插件提高文档站点在搜索引擎中的排名,或者使用分析插件了解用户对文档的访问行为。这些插件能够轻松集成到 VitePress 项目中,为文档创作和站点管理提供更多便利和功能增强。
  2. 共享 Vite 的高效开发体验:VitePress 继承了 Vite 的优秀开发体验,包括快速的构建速度、高效的模块热替换以及简洁的配置方式。开发者在使用 VitePress 时,能够感受到与 Vite 项目一致的高效开发流程,无需额外学习复杂的工具链和构建流程。同时,VitePress 与 Vite 的生态系统相互促进,共同发展,为开发者提供了一个统一、高效的前端开发环境,无论是构建文档站点还是应用程序,都能在这个生态系统中找到合适的工具和解决方案。

开源与社区驱动的发展模式

 

  1. 免费开源的共享精神:VitePress 采用开源模式,基于 MIT 许可证发布,这意味着开发者可以自由使用、修改和分发 VitePress 的源代码。这种开源精神鼓励了全球开发者的参与和贡献,促进了技术的不断创新和改进。无论是个人开发者还是企业团队,都可以在 VitePress 的基础上进行定制化开发,满足自己的特定需求,同时也可以将自己的改进和优化回馈给社区,共同推动 VitePress 的发展。
  2. 活跃的社区支持与资源共享:VitePress 拥有一个活跃的社区,社区成员积极分享使用经验、开发技巧和自定义主题等资源。在社区中,开发者可以获取到丰富的文档模板、插件推荐、常见问题解答等信息,遇到问题时也可以向社区寻求帮助。同时,社区还定期举办交流活动和讨论,促进开发者之间的知识共享和合作,形成了一个良好的学习和成长环境。这种社区驱动的发展模式使得 VitePress 能够不断适应开发者的需求,持续进化和完善。

 

VitePress 以其专注于内容创作的理念、卓越的性能表现、强大的定制化能力以及与 Vite 生态系统的紧密结合,为开发者提供了一个高效、灵活且功能强大的文档站点生成解决方案。无论是构建个人技术博客、团队项目文档还是开源项目的官方文档,VitePress 都能帮助开发者快速打造出美观、实用的文档站点,提升知识传播和项目协作的效率。

数据评估

VitePress浏览人数已经达到527,如你需要查询该站的相关权重信息,可以点击"5118数据""爱站数据""Chinaz数据"进入;以目前的网站数据参考,建议大家请以爱站数据为准,更多网站价值评估因素如:VitePress的访问速度、搜索引擎收录以及索引量、用户体验等;当然要评估一个站的价值,最主要还是需要根据您自身的需求以及需要,一些确切的数据则需要找VitePress的站长进行洽谈提供。如该站的IP、PV、跳出率等!

关于VitePress特别声明

本站学习导航提供的VitePress都来源于网络,不保证外部链接的准确性和完整性,同时,对于该外部链接的指向,不由学习导航实际控制,在2024年11月23日 上午11:01收录时,该网页上的内容,都属于合规合法,后期网页的内容如出现违规,可以直接联系网站管理员进行删除,学习导航不承担任何责任。

相关导航

暂无评论

您必须登录才能参与评论!
立即登录
none
暂无评论...